Simplify Algebraic Expressions When addition or subtraction signs separate an algebraic expression into parts, each part is called a term. The numerical factor of a term that contains a variable is called a coefficient of the variable.
5
Like terms contain the same variables to the same powers. For example 3x and 7x are like terms. So are 8xy 2 and 12xy 2. A term without a variable is called a constant.

An algebraic expression is in simplest form if it has no like terms and no parenthesis. Example: Write 4y + y in simplest form 4y + y = 4y + 1y multiplicative identity property; y=1y 5y
9
Write 7x − 2 − 7x + 6 in simplest form 7x − 2 − 7x + 6 = 7x + (-2) + (-7x) + 6 Definition of subtraction = 7x + (-7x) + (-2) + 6 Commutative Property = (0)x + 4 = 0 + 4 = 4 Multiplicative Property of Zero
